    Outdoor wood boiler radiant floor heat

    If you set it up as a secondary loop, the primary loop pump will not move any water in the secondary loop by design. You'll need a small pump to move the water in the secondary loop. You can tie the secondary pump to a transformer that is tied into a thermostat (a slab sensing kind is better...

    Outdoor wood boiler radiant floor heat

    I was recently trying to figure this very thing out. Look up primary and secondary loops. You can run the 160-185 degree water in a primary loop that runs from the boiler, to the house, and back to the boiler. You then can pull secondary loops off of the primary for the floor zones. Use the...
